The quality of educational leadership, and that of the school principal in particular, is an important factor in school reform. This essay addresses concerns that the teaching profession and, as a result, the prospect of school reform is under threat from forces that seek to transform the role of school principal to that of corporate executive. It does so by identifying and examining persistent themes in the work of the Fordham Institute and confronting them with arguments and research that challenges this view.
